Transaction 33beaffbc7b2f6eb211e68263bebdc369301002180b7afa24c265f73debda302
1 Input
1 Output
-
33beaffbc7b2f6eb211e68263bebdc369301002180b7afa24c265f73debda302:0
- value
- 256669
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d26298f53dfbd007e51e8ec96e3c215c6a1255f
- address
- bc1qm5nznr6nm77sqlj3arkfdc7zzhr2zf2lg3up0a